Dectector dog Sam sniffs out €97,000 worth of illegal drugs in Portlaoise

Yesterday Revenue officers in Portlaoise Mail Centre, assisted by detector dog Sam, seized drugs worth €97,000.

In a series of operations arising from routine profiling, officers seized approximately 4.7kgs of herbal cannabis with an estimated street value of €94,000.

The cannabis was found in a parcel which had orignated from Canada and was declared as ‘clothing’.

Separately yesterday, 6kgs of Khat was also discovered.

The Khat, with an estimated value of €3,000, was detected in a parcel, also declared as ‘clothing’, and had originated from Kenya.

Both parcels containing the illegal drugs were destined for addresses in Dublin City.

Investigations are on-going with a view to prosecutions.

These seizures are part of Revenue’s ongoing operations targeting drug importations.
